Tạo Tóm tắt Phóng to Bài thuyết trình với Aspose.Slides

Giới thiệu

Trong lĩnh vực thuyết trình nhanh, Aspose.Slides for .NET nổi lên như một công cụ mạnh mẽ để nâng cao trải nghiệm tạo slide của bạn. Một trong những tính năng nổi bật của nó là Summary Zoom, cung cấp phương pháp trực quan hấp dẫn để trình bày một bộ sưu tập slide. Hướng dẫn này sẽ hướng dẫn bạn quy trình tạo Summary Zoom trong bài thuyết trình của bạn bằng Aspose.Slides for .NET.

Điều kiện tiên quyết

Trước khi bắt đầu hướng dẫn, hãy đảm bảo bạn đã thiết lập xong những điều sau:

  • Aspose.Slides cho .NET: Tải xuống và cài đặt thư viện từtrang phát hành.
  • Môi trường phát triển: Sử dụng Visual Studio hoặc bất kỳ IDE nào bạn thích để phát triển .NET.
  • Kiến thức cơ bản về C#: Sự quen thuộc với lập trình C# sẽ hữu ích cho hướng dẫn này.

Nhập các không gian tên cần thiết

Bắt đầu bằng cách bao gồm các không gian tên cần thiết khi bắt đầu dự án C# của bạn để truy cập các chức năng của Aspose.Slides:

using System;
using System.Drawing;
using System.IO;
using Aspose.Slides;
using Aspose.Slides.Export;

Bước 1: Thiết lập bài thuyết trình

Đầu tiên, bạn sẽ tạo một bài thuyết trình mới.using câu lệnh đảm bảo rằng các tài nguyên được giải phóng đúng cách khi bản trình bày được đóng lại. Chỉ định đường dẫn và tên tệp cho tệp kết quả vớiresultPath biến:

string dataDir = "Your Documents Directory";
string resultPath = Path.Combine(dataDir, "SummaryZoomPresentation.pptx");

using (Presentation pres = new Presentation())
{
    // Tiến hành tạo slide và phần ở đây
    // ...
    
    // Lưu bài thuyết trình
    pres.Save(resultPath, SaveFormat.Pptx);
}

Bước 2: Thêm Slide và Phần

Tiếp theo, tạo các slide riêng lẻ và sắp xếp chúng thành các phần. Sử dụngAddEmptySlide phương pháp để thêm các slide mới và sử dụngSections.AddSection phương pháp tổ chức tốt hơn:

ISlide slide = pres.Slides.AddEmptySlide(pres.Slides[0].LayoutSlide);
// Tùy chỉnh slide ở đây
// ...
pres.Sections.AddSection("Section 1", slide);
// Lặp lại cho các phần bổ sung (Phần 2, Phần 3, Phần 4)

Bước 3: Tùy chỉnh hình nền của slide

Tăng cường sức hấp dẫn trực quan của mỗi slide bằng cách tùy chỉnh nền. Đặt loại tô, màu tô đặc và loại nền:

slide.Background.FillFormat.FillType = FillType.Solid;
slide.Background.FillFormat.SolidFillColor.Color = Color.Brown; // Chọn màu theo ý muốn
slide.Background.Type = BackgroundType.OwnBackground;
// Lặp lại tùy chỉnh cho các slide khác với màu sắc khác nhau

Bước 4: Thêm Khung Thu phóng Tóm tắt

Tạo khung Tóm tắt Thu phóng, đóng vai trò là thành phần trực quan liên kết các phần của bài thuyết trình của bạn. Sử dụngAddSummaryZoomFrame phương pháp để thêm tính năng này vào slide đã chỉ định:

ISummaryZoomFrame summaryZoomFrame = pres.Slides[0].Shapes.AddSummaryZoomFrame(150, 50, 300, 200);
// Điều chỉnh tọa độ và kích thước khi cần thiết

Bước 5: Lưu bài thuyết trình của bạn

Cuối cùng, lưu bản trình bày của bạn vào đường dẫn tệp mong muốn. Bước này đảm bảo rằng tất cả các thay đổi đều được giữ nguyên:

pres.Save(resultPath, SaveFormat.Pptx);

Thông qua các bước này, bạn có thể tạo một bài thuyết trình được sắp xếp gọn gàng với khung Tóm tắt thu phóng hấp dẫn về mặt hình ảnh bằng Aspose.Slides cho .NET.

Phần kết luận

Aspose.Slides for .NET giúp bạn nâng cao bài thuyết trình của mình và tính năng Summary Zoom tăng thêm tính chuyên nghiệp và sự tương tác. Với các bước được nêu, bạn có thể tăng cường sức hấp dẫn trực quan của slide với nỗ lực tối thiểu.

Câu hỏi thường gặp

Tôi có thể tùy chỉnh giao diện của khung Tóm tắt thu phóng không?

Có, bạn có thể điều chỉnh tọa độ và kích thước cho phù hợp với yêu cầu thiết kế của mình.

Aspose.Slides có tương thích với phiên bản .NET mới nhất không?

Có, Aspose.Slides được cập nhật thường xuyên để tương thích với các phiên bản .NET mới nhất.

Tôi có thể thêm siêu liên kết vào khung Tóm tắt Zoom không?

Chắc chắn rồi! Các siêu liên kết được thêm vào trang chiếu của bạn sẽ hoạt động liền mạch trong khung Tóm tắt thu phóng.

Có giới hạn về số phần trong một bài thuyết trình không?

Hiện tại, không có giới hạn nghiêm ngặt nào về số phần bạn có thể thêm vào bài thuyết trình.

Có phiên bản dùng thử nào cho Aspose.Slides không?

Có, bạn có thể khám phá các tính năng của Aspose.Slides bằng cách tải xuốngphiên bản dùng thử miễn phí.